Step-by-Step Application Process
Choose Program & University
2-3 monthsResearch programs and universities that match your interests and qualifications
Tips: Use DAAD database, check rankings, program requirements
Prepare Documents
1-2 monthsGather academic transcripts, language certificates, motivation letter, CV
Tips: Get documents translated and notarized, prepare strong SOP
Submit Applications
1 monthApply through uni-assist or directly to universities before deadlines
Tips: Apply to 3-5 universities, pay attention to deadlines
Get Admission Letter
2-4 monthsReceive acceptance letter and enrollment confirmation
Tips: Respond quickly to university communications
Apply for Student Visa
4-8 weeksSubmit visa application with all required documents
Tips: Book appointment early, prepare financial proof
Prepare for Departure
1-2 monthsArrange accommodation, health insurance, travel plans
Tips: Join student groups, learn basic German phrases
